suhog
Hungarian
Etymology
From an onomatopoeic (sound-imitative) root + -og (frequentative verb-forming suffix).[1]
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): [ˈʃuɦoɡ]
- Hyphenation: su‧hog
Verb
suhog
- (intransitive) to swish, to rustle, to whiz
